Project

General

Profile

bug #7641

Reference editor: Error when incerting several new authors into a new author team

Added by Wolf-Henning Kusber 4 months ago. Updated 4 months ago.

Status:
Closed
Priority:
Highest
Category:
cdm-vaadin
Target version:
Start date:
08/08/2018
Due date:
% Done:

100%

Severity:
blocker
Found in Version:
Tags:

Description

Collection team:

A collection team was built with new members as

Owsianny, P.M., Marciniak G. & Trawiński, K.
This team was created for 100118, and saved
This team was used for 100119

For 100123 it tried to select this team but it appeared as
Owsianny, P.M., Trawiński, K. & Trawiński, K.
Team for 100118 and 100119 appeared changed, too.

picture645-1.png View (57.7 KB) Wolf-Henning Kusber, 08/08/2018 03:30 PM

picture58-1.png View (60.2 KB) Wolf-Henning Kusber, 08/15/2018 11:44 AM

picture395-1.png View (63.1 KB) Wolf-Henning Kusber, 08/15/2018 12:06 PM


Related issues

Related to Edit - bug #7709: CdmTransientEntityCacher cannot handle multiple unpersisted entities of the same type In Progress 08/30/2018

Associated revisions

Revision fe3180d3 (diff)
Added by Andreas Kohlbecker 4 months ago

fix #7641 ignoring unpersisted entities in ToOneRelatedEntityReloader

History

#1 Updated by Andreas Kohlbecker 4 months ago

  • Subject changed from PhycoBank Vaadin to unexpected collection team titleCaches
  • Category set to cdm-vaadin
  • Target version changed from Unassigned CDM tickets to Release 5.2

#2 Updated by Wolf-Henning Kusber 4 months ago

2018-08-15
Documentation http://test.e-taxonomy.eu/cdmserver/phycobank_production/app/registration#!workingset/8be1a6d5-ffb0-4ad5-b4a5-ee10af0ca7da

Reference: Lange-Bertalot H., Cavacini P., Tagliaventi N. & Alfinito S. 2003: Diatoms of Sardinia. Rare and 76 new species in rock pools and other ephemeral waters. – Pp. [1]-438 in Lange-Bertalot H. (ed.): Iconographia Diatomologica 12. – Ruggell: A.R.G. Gantner Verlag K.G.
Team not in the system:
Step one:
Create new team
Step two: select Lange-Bertalot, H.
Step three: new and put in P. Paolo Cavacini
Step four: new and put in N. Nadine Tagliaventi
Step five: new and put in S. Silvia Alfinito
No saving between step two and step 6

Step six. Save record

After Saving the reference editor show Lange-Bertalot, Alfinito, Alfinito & Alfinito = the last new team member replaces also new team member 2 and new team member 3.

#3 Updated by Wolf-Henning Kusber 4 months ago

http://test.e-taxonomy.eu/cdmserver/phycobank_production/app/registration#!workingset/1c70fa46-c7a5-43e7-922a-379b20092077

Documentation:
Original reference
Antoniades D., Hamilton P.B., Douglas M.S.V. & Smol J.P. 2008: Diatoms of North America: The freshwater floras of Prince Patrick, Ellef Ringnes and northern Ellesmere Islands from the Canadian Artic Archipelago. – Pp. 1-649 in Lange-Bertalot H. (ed.): Iconographia Diatomologica 17. – Ruggell: A.R.G. Gantner Verlag K.G.

Antoniades entered newly
Hamilton selected
Douglas entered newly
Smol entered newly
Team: Smol, Hamilton, Smol & Smol

Last new entered Autor overwrites all other newly entered names of the team (screen shot)

#4 Updated by Wolf-Henning Kusber 4 months ago

All new authors, except the last one are not saved = they can not be selected.

#5 Updated by Wolf-Henning Kusber 4 months ago

  • Subject changed from unexpected collection team titleCaches to Reference editor: Error when incerting several new author an a new author team

#6 Updated by Wolf-Henning Kusber 4 months ago

  • Subject changed from Reference editor: Error when incerting several new author an a new author team to Reference editor: Error when incerting several new authors into a new author team

#7 Updated by Andreas Kohlbecker 4 months ago

  • Target version changed from Release 5.2 to Release 5.3

#8 Updated by Andreas Kohlbecker 4 months ago

  • Priority changed from New to Highest
  • Severity changed from critical to blocker

#9 Updated by Andreas Kohlbecker 4 months ago

  • Related to bug #7709: CdmTransientEntityCacher cannot handle multiple unpersisted entities of the same type added

#10 Updated by Andreas Kohlbecker 4 months ago

  • Status changed from New to Resolved
  • % Done changed from 0 to 50

#11 Updated by Andreas Kohlbecker 4 months ago

  • Assignee changed from Andreas Kohlbecker to Wolf-Henning Kusber

Problem solved, please test.

#12 Updated by Wolf-Henning Kusber 4 months ago

  • Status changed from Resolved to Closed
  • Assignee changed from Wolf-Henning Kusber to Andreas Kohlbecker
  • % Done changed from 50 to 100

Test 1: #3, #6, 3.screenshot: fehlerhaftes Team komplett gelöscht und neu angelegt mit 2 Autoren aus der Liste und 2 komplett neu anglegt. Alles zusammen abgespeicher und kontrolliert: Fehlerfrei.

Test 2: #4, #6, 2. screenshot: Das Autenteam beibehalten aber die 2 Doppelten aus dem Team gelöscht und 2 Autoren komplett neu angelegt. Alles zusammen abgespeicher und kontrolliert: Fehlerfrei.

Danke!

Also available in: Atom PDF

Add picture from clipboard (Maximum size: 40 MB)